Thereof Is Trikafta a cure for cystic fibrosis? Trikafta® is a highly effective therapy for the underlying cause of cystic fibrosis. It is approved for use in people with CF ages 6 and older who have at least one copy of the F508del mutation or certain mutations in the CFTR gene that are responsive based on lab data. It is not a cure for CF.

Why is Trikafta a breakthrough?

Unlike previously available modulator therapies, TRIKAFTA is the first approved three-drug combo that targets the Phe508del mutation, where the protein improperly folds, gets stuck in the cell, and ultimately degrades there without reaching the surface to function.

How effective is Trikafta? Data from both studies showed significant improvements in lung function in Trikafta-treated patients, with ppFEV1 improving by an average of 14.3% for this group in AURORA F/MF, and by 10% for those in AURORA F/F. Patients generally tolerated the treatment well.

Can a lung transplant cure CF? Transplantation is an important treatment option for damaged CF lungs, but unfortunately it is not a cure for CF. The lungs that are transplanted into the recipient’s body do not have cystic fibrosis because they have the DNA of the person who donated them, and not the DNA that the transplant recipient was born with.

Does Trikafta affect fertility? As with other modulator drugs, Trikafta may increase female fertility because it thins out cervical mucus (link to fertility guide).

Does Trikafta affect birth control? Although elexacaftor/tezacaftor/ivacaftor (Trikafta®) does not impact the effectiveness of oral contraceptives, in phase III studies of Trikafta®, a higher incidence of rash occurred in women who were taking oral contraception and Trikafta®.

Why can’t you eat grapefruit with Trikafta?

Avoid foods and drinks that contain grapefruit while taking TRIKAFTA because they may affect the amount of TRIKAFTA in your body.

Can you eat grapefruit with Trikafta? You should not drink grapefruit juice while taking Trikafta, as it may moderately inhibit CYP3A. Before starting Trikafta tell your doctor if you: Have a history or liver or kidney problems. Are taking any antibiotics, including rifabutin, rifampin, clarithromycin, erythromycin, or telithromycin.

Why does Trikafta need to be taken with fat?

Each dose must be taken with fat-containing food:

Always take TRIKAFTA with a meal or snack that contains fat to help your body absorb the medicine. Examples of fat-containing foods include butter, peanut butter, eggs, nuts, meat, and whole-milk dairy products such as whole milk, cheese, and yogurt.

Will CF affect new lungs? No. Cystic fibrosis is a genetic condition so even though the transplanted lungs will not have CF and will never develop it, the rest of the person’s body will continue to have cystic fibrosis. This means that following a successful lung transplant, some CF treatment will still be needed.
